Abstract

Sodium bicarbonate is an ergogenic extracellular buffering agent that has recently garnered more interest because novel formulations purported to mitigate gastrointestinal symptoms, thereby increasing use with high-profile athletes. The effects of sodium bicarbonate on various aspects of exercise performance have been explored in hundreds of scientific articles. However, questions persist about aspects of its effectiveness and the potential side effects associated with the extracellular buffer. In this review, we provide answers to several questions related to sodium bicarbonate supplementation. These questions covered include: (1) What are sodium bicarbonate's proposed mechanisms for enhancing performance? (2) Does sodium bicarbonate cause gastrointestinal symptoms, and why? (3) What are the different ways in which sodium bicarbonate can be ingested, and how does this affect blood bicarbonate changes and exercise performance? (4) How does sodium bicarbonate affect performance in short-duration exercise (≤10 min)? (5) How does sodium bicarbonate affect performance in long-duration exercise, and should it be used before and during such events? (6) Is there a potential rationale for sodium bicarbonate use at altitude? (7) Is it worth ingesting sodium bicarbonate for exercise in the heat? (8) When is the best time to take sodium bicarbonate before exercise? When does blood bicarbonate peak in the blood? (9) What happens when sodium bicarbonate is taken after exercise instead of before? (10) Should sodium bicarbonate be taken throughout training, or can it be taken just during the day of a competition/game/race? Are there benefits of taking sodium bicarbonate for training adaptations? (11) Which sports mainly benefit from sodium bicarbonate supplementation? (12) Should one worry about the sodium dose? (13) How does extracellular buffering compare to intracellular buffering agents such as beta-alanine? (14) Is there a possible placebo effect with sodium bicarbonate? (15) Are the ergogenic effects of sodium bicarbonate sex-specific? To address these questions, we conducted an evidence-based review of the literature on sodium bicarbonate supplementation, with contributions from several invited experts. Comprehensive answers are provided alongside suggestions for future research.
